Overview

Postcode L7 0JL is located in a major urban area, within the Kensington & Fairfield ward of Liverpool in the North West region, and forms part of the Fairfield West & Newsham Park area. It has very high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 159.4 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. The average income per household in Fairfield West & Newsham Park is £35,563 per year. The nearest station is Wavertree Technology Park located about 0.6 miles away. There are 13 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area.
